登录/注册

esp32 Arduino flash模式

更多

在 ESP32 的 Arduino 开发环境中,Flash 模式通常指芯片与外部 SPI Flash 存储器之间的通信方式和配置。以下是关键设置和说明:


如何设置 Flash 模式?

  1. 打开 Arduino IDE
    确保已安装 ESP32 Arduino 开发板支持包(通过 Boards Manager)。

  2. 选择开发板型号
    在菜单栏选择:
    工具 > 开发板 > ESP32 Arduino → 选择你的具体型号(如 ESP32 Dev Module)。

  3. 配置 Flash 参数
    工具 菜单中调整以下选项:

    • Flash Mode:
      • DIO(Dual I/O):数据和指令均通过 2 个引脚传输(兼容性强,默认推荐)。
      • QIO(Quad I/O):数据和指令均通过 4 个引脚传输(速度更快,需硬件支持)。
      • DOUT(Dual Output):数据通过 2 个引脚输出,指令通过 1 个引脚输入。
      • QOUT(Quad Output):数据通过 4 个引脚输出,指令通过 1 个引脚输入。
    • Flash Size:
      根据硬件选择 Flash 容量(如 4MB (32Mb)16MB (128Mb) 等)。
    • Partition Scheme:
      选择分区方案(例如 Default 4MB with spiffsHuge APP (3MB No OTA))。
  4. 上传速度(Upload Speed)
    建议设置为 921600115200(若遇到上传失败,可降低速度)。


常见问题

  1. 上传失败或无法启动

    • 检查 Flash Mode 是否与硬件兼容(多数模块默认支持 DIO)。
    • 降低 Upload Speed 或尝试 QIO 模式(需硬件支持 Quad SPI)。
  2. 代码过大导致编译报错

    • 选择更大的 Flash Size 或调整 Partition Scheme(如 Huge APP)。
  3. SPIFFS 文件系统问题

    • 确保 Partition Scheme 包含 SPIFFS(如 Default 4MB with spiffs)。

注意事项

如果仍存在问题,请检查硬件连接(如 SPI 引脚是否虚焊)或尝试更换 Flash 模式。

esp32外置flash的大小

的Flash存储芯片,用于扩展ESP32的存储容量。 ESP32外置Flash

2024-01-09 11:24:25

如何在Arduino IDE中安装ESP32开发环境

要在Arduino IDE中使用ESP32开发板,您需要先安装相应的开发环境。以下是在Arduino IDE中安装

2023-07-13 16:48:45

ESP32-WROOM-32-N8

ESP32-WROOM-32-N8

2023-04-06 23:33:39

基于ESP32Arduino兼容系统

电子发烧友网站提供《基于ESP32的Arduino兼容系统.zip》资料免费下载

资料下载 佚名 2022-12-20 17:53:46

ESP32 Flash加密指南

电子发烧友网站提供《ESP32 Flash加密指南.pdf》资料免费下载

资料下载 佚名 2022-09-23 10:00:19

使用Arduino开发ESP32-01S

使用Arduino开发ESP32-01S

资料下载 名士流 2021-12-03 18:06:06

ESP32-Arduino-开发实例-ESP32的WiFi工作模式

ESP32的WiFi工作模式NodeMCU-32S 最强的ESP32 开发板非盗版或副厂的CH340 WiFi 蓝牙

资料下载 mintsy 2021-11-26 17:21:15

ESP32 开发之旅② Arduino For ESP32说明

文章目录1. Arduino Core For ESP32是什么?2.Arduino core for

资料下载 无人岛 2021-11-13 19:51:01

ESP32-S3-MINI-1-N8

ESP32-S3-MINI-1-N8

2023-04-06 23:31:21

ESP32-S3-WROOM-1U-N4

ESP32-S3-WROOM-1U-N4

2023-04-06 23:08:04

ESP32-WROOM-32U-N8

ESP32-WROOM-32U-N8

2023-03-29 22:42:58

ESP32-S3-WROOM-1-N8R8

ESP32-S3-WROOM-1-N8R8

2023-03-29 21:34:19

ESP32-C3-MINI-1-H4

ESP32-C3-MINI-1-H4

2023-03-29 16:30:23

ESP32-S0WD

ESP32-S0WD

2023-03-28 13:10:29

esp32arduino的区别,esp32能否替代arduino

很多创客爱好者甚至有些技术工程师在理解esp32和arduino的时候总是问一句这两块板子哪个更好用?他们可能潜意识中就觉得arduino和

2021-06-24 17:11:02

7天热门专题 换一换
相关标签